Phantom nationals this year every competitor got a prize, t-sh*ts, gloves, water bottles, bags, buoyancy aides etc etc thanks to very generous sponsors, including: Allen Brothers, , Morgan sails, North sails, Moatt sails, Dimension Polyant, Ovington Boats , Crewsaver, Southern Ropes, Selden Masts and Office Design Works, Vickys Embroidery services and Pinnel and Bax. The biggest prizes of a new sail and the cloth to have a sail built at your preferred sail maker, were awarded by the most deserving by the committee. Lots of very happy competitors.

As a class the B14 fleet has been exceptionally fortunate to have the sponsorship of Gul for many years. The sponsorship consisted of vouchers we could spend with Gul within a year of winning them. They were awarded to the top 3 usually and then another 4-6 vouchers to boats down the fleet. Race winners, endurance, first timers etc etc etc.... So lots of prizes, high value (£50/£25/£10) spread through the fleet So the top 3 boats (helm and crew) are very often in the top slots very often so receive these prizes very often... My question is (of those top sailors) is it right that the same sailors receive these decent prizes time and time again? Would it be demotivating if the prizes were concentrated lower down in the fleet and the top 3 just received the usual club prizes? ie glasses etc Would those top sailors move to another class? Or is it the class itself that's the reason they sail it and the prizes don't matter. "Just winning is good enough for me" Or do they??? (matter)?
